Abstract
The invention provides a method for enhancing resistance in plants by providing these plants with a gene construct comprising a DNA sequence coding for a receptor for a systemic signal compound, wherein such a systemic signal compound is one or more of the group consisting of salicylic acid, jasmonic acid and brassinosteroids. The resistance can the be induced by contacting said plants with said signal compound. Preferably, the receptor is an RKS receptor, salicylic acid receptor or jasmonic acid receptor. Also combinations and/or chimaeric receptors can be applied.
